I have built a small class that uses Crystal engine and Crystal Shared classes to convert existing templates reports to acrobat files.

This file is pretty small and does not use any of the fancy stuff that can be found in crystal enterprise

am I in breach of licence rights by using such file in on a server?

Depends on your version/edition/license of Crystal, wouldn't you think?

Try posting specifics...

Licensing changed after CR 8.5 in terms of the Broadcast License, but this is a subject of constat debate, and with the CBL there was the 50 viewers issue.

I suggest that you ask around, but ultimately pose the what if to BO.

Licensing is very complex and varies depending on the use you plan to make of that app built with the BO/Crystal components:
For example, read this info:
Code:
3.3.3.2  Use of the Runtime Product.  Licensee may install and 
use a single copy of the Runtime Product to develop Client 
Applications and Server Applications.  The Distribution and 
Deployment terms and conditions differ based on the type of 
applications Licensee develop, as described in the following 
sections.

3.3.3.3  Deployment and Distribution of Client Applications.  
Licensor grants Licensee a personal, nonexclusive, limited license 
to Deploy, reproduce and Distribute Client Applications to end 
users, if Licensee complies with all of the terms of this license 
agreement, including without limitation section 3.3.3.6.  Crystal 
Reports Advanced Developer includes the right to develop and 
Deploy Client Applications utilizing the Report Creation API 
("RCAPI").  If Licensee Distributes Client Applications utilizing the 
RCAPI ("RCAPI Applications"), Licensee must obtain a license 
from Licensor to do so.  Additional information is available at  the 
Business Objects web site  
([URL unfurl="true"]http://www.businessobjects.com/products/reporting/crystalreports[/URL]
/licensing/default.asp). If Licensee obtains a license from Licensor 
to distribute RCAPI Applications to third parties, Licensee may 
reproduce and Distribute copies of RCAPI Applications to end 
users so long as Licensee complies with all of the terms of such 
license and this license agreement, including without limitation 
section 3.3.3.6.

3.3.3.4 Deployment of Server Applications.  Licensee may 
Deploy multiple Server Applications within Licensee's 
organization provided that each Server Application or Project may 
Access the Runtime Product on only one Processor.  Under no 
circumstances may Licensee allow a Server Application or Project 
to Access the Runtime Product on more than one Processor by 
combining additional Product licenses, other Licensor products 
that include the Runtime Product, promotional offers of any kind, 
or by any other means, unless Licensee acquires additional 
Processor licenses for additional Runtime Product scalability. 

3.3.3.5 Distribution of Server Applications.  This Agreement 
does not in itself give Licensee any right to Distribute Server 
Applications to third parties.  If Licensee wants to Distribute 
Server Applications to third parties, Licensee must obtain a 
license from Licensor to do so.  Additional information is available 
at the Business Objects web site  
([URL unfurl="true"]http://www.businessobjects.com/products/reporting/crystalreports[/URL]
/licensing/default.asp).  If Licensee obtains a license from 
Licensor to distribute Server Applications to third parties, 
Licensee may reproduce and Distribute copies of Server 
Applications to end users of Server Applications so long as 
Licensee complies with all of the terms of such license and this 
license agreement, including without limitation section 3.3.3.6. 

3.3.3.6 Runtime Product Distribution Requirements.  If 
Licensee Distributes the Runtime Product to third parties pursuant 
to sections 3.3.3.3 or 3.3.3.5, Licensee agrees to comply with the 
following requirements:
(a)	Licensee Distributes copies of the Runtime Product solely as 
a part of an application that adds specific and primary functionality 
to the Runtime Product or the associated application;
(b)	Licensee remains solely responsible for support, service, 
upgrades, and technical or other assistance, required or 
requested by anyone receiving such Runtime Product copies or 
sample applications;
(c)	Licensee does not use the name, logo, or trademark of 
Licensor, or the Product, without prior written permission from 
Licensor;
(d)	Licensee will defend, indemnify and hold Licensor harmless 
against any claims or liabilities arising out of the use, reproduction 
or distribution of Runtime Product;
(e)	Licensee shall not distribute the Runtime Product with any 
general-purpose report writing, data analysis or report delivery 
product or any other product that performs the same or similar 
functions as Licensor product offerings;
(f)	Licensee shall secure the end user's ("End User") consent to 
terms substantially similar to the following:  
End User agrees not to alter, disassemble, decompile, 
translate, adapt or reverse-engineer the Runtime Product or 
the report file (.RPT) format;
End User agrees not to distribute the Runtime Product to 
any third party;
End User agrees not to use the Runtime Product to create 
for distribution a product that is generally competitive with 
Licensor product offerings;
End User agrees not to use the Runtime Product to create 
for distribution a product that converts the report file (.RPT) 
format to an alternative report file format used by any 
general-purpose report writing, data analysis or report 
delivery product that is not the property of Licensor;
End User agrees not to use the Product on a rental or 
timesharing basis or to operate a service bureau facility for 
the benefit of third-parties;
Licensor and its suppliers DISCLAIM ALL WARRANTIES, 
EXPRESS OR IMPLIED, INCLUDING WITHOUT 
LIMITATION THE WARRANTIES OF MERCHANTABILITY, 
F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E, AND 
NONINFRINGEMENT OF THIRD PARTY RIGHTS.  
Licensor AND ITS SUPPLIERS SHALL HAVE NO LIABILITY 
WHATSOEVER FOR ANY DIRECT, INDIRECT, 
CONSEQUENTIAL, INCIDENTAL, PUNITIVE, COVER OR 
OTHER DAMAGES ARISING UNDER THIS AGREEMENT 
OR IN CONNECTION WITH THE SOFTWARE.
